Pathway rep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the safety, appearance, and functionality of walkways, driveways, and other paved surfaces around residential properties. Over time, pathways can develop cracks, uneven sections, or surface deterioration due to weather exposure, heavy foot traffic, or shifting soil. Skilled service providers assess the condition of existing surfaces and perform necessary repairs to prevent further damage. This may include patching cracks, leveling uneven areas, or resurfacing to ensure pathways remain safe and visually appealing.
Many common problems can be addressed through pathway repair, including cracked or crumbling concrete, broken or loose pavers, and sunken or heaving surfaces. These issues can pose tripping hazards or cause water to pool, which may lead to more extensive damage if left unaddressed. Repair services help to stabilize the surface, improve drainage, and extend the lifespan of the pathways. In some cases, contractors may recommend replacing sections or entire surfaces to achieve a durable, long-lasting result.

The overview below groups typical Pathway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in West Des Moines,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or pathway repairs in West Des Moines range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as crack sealing or patching, fall within this range. Larger or more complex small repairs may approach the upper end of this spectrum.
Moderate Repairs - mid-sized projects like replacing sections of damaged pathway or addressing uneven surfaces often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ive work than minor repairs.
Major Repairs - extensive repairs, such as significant resurfacing or structural reinforcement, can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, typically involving more complex or larger-scale work.
Full Replacement - complete pathway replacement in West Des Moines generally costs $3,500 and up, with larger projects potentially exceeding $5,000. These are reserved for extensive damage or outdated pathways requiring total overhaul.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
